Pirozhki are small filled buns or pastries from Eastern European cuisine, typically made with a yeasted or short dough and stuffed with fillings such as minced meat, cabbage, potato, egg, or fruit. They are baked or fried and served as a snack, side dish, or light meal across Russian and Ukrainian households. How many calories in pirozhki?
Pirozhki contain 270 kcal per 100 g. A single medium pirozhok typically weighs around 80–100 g, putting one piece at roughly 215–270 kcal depending on size and filling.
How much sodium is in pirozhki?
Pirozhki contain 320 mg of sodium per 100 g, which is relatively notable for a baked good. This comes from both the dough and the seasoned filling.
Are pirozhki vegetarian-friendly?
Pirozhki can be vegetarian when made with fillings such as cabbage, potato, mushroom, or egg and cheese. The data lists them as suitable for a vegetarian diet, though meat-filled varieties are also common and would not qualify.
